## Runbook: Compaction Rollout

Quick note for the sync — Tolloway's queue compaction now runs hourly instead of daily, so expect segment counts to drop sharply after deploy. If consumers lag, bump the retention floor before panicking. Compacted segments get re-signed at publish time, which is the bit that trips people up. The publisher verifies each segment against the key below.

release key, kahif-yagap: bky3_1JN

Ticket #—: Missed pick-up, Corvale office move. Driver did not arrive at the Timberrow Street loading bay during the booked 14:00–16:00 window. Eleven crates and two server cabinets still staged on level 2. Rebook for tomorrow, first slot. Site security needs notice by 08:00. On arrival, the driver must give reception the following phrase:

courier memo of yawep-yafog: the pramir ulaix courier leaves the ulavan aldix frair zorok oliiel joreth rusdor fenvan ledger at gate 1305 under passcode 514738

### Step 4 — Point Nightwick at the new backfill scheduler

Okay, this is the fiddly bit. The old cron-based backfills are gone; Nightwick now owns all nightly data backfills and retries failed partitions automatically. If a customer reports stale dashboards, check Nightwick's run history first before escalating — nine times out of ten it's a skipped partition. The scheduler keeps its run ledger in its own database, and it connects using the string below.

warehouse DSN: postgresql://aldion_svc:19@db-7018.torvadata.example:5432/silok

Ticket OPS-2241 — Vault locked, blocking image slimming work

Hey on-call: the Tarnish build vault auto-locked mid-run, so the Slimjig pipeline can't pull base layers for the container slimming job. Images are stuck at the old 1.2GB size until we unseal. Nothing's on fire, but the nightly rebuild will fail. Unseal from the ops bastion; the prompt takes the recovery passphrase below.

unlock words, yadup-yagef: zorael-druix